Challenge and Opportunity of Advanced Materials and Chemistries for Electrochemical Energy Storages Development of NASA Future MissionsThe energy demanding for NASA's future missions, and the challenges and opportunities to achieve these energy goals will be presented. The research capabilities, facilities and activities at NASA Glenn Research Center will also be discussed. The opportunity for university faculty and students to participate in NASA energy-related programs will be discussed at well.
